Transaction 81a27bc94e48908e78acfe9060f4f88b6390ce185700b6d6ce7111032a01b668
1 Input
1 Output
-
81a27bc94e48908e78acfe9060f4f88b6390ce185700b6d6ce7111032a01b668:0
- value
- 127010908
- script pubkey
- OP_0 OP_PUSHBYTES_20 d9aeb37b67dd301318cafdbe7813a4c45bed3537
- address
- bc1qmxhtx7m8m5cpxxx2lkl8syayc3d76dfhaeqw3z